FBS offers the MetaTrader 4 and MetaTrader 5 platforms, which are industry standards with advanced charting and automated trading. Libertex provides its proprietary web and mobile platform, which is more user-friendly but less customizable. For Botswana traders, FBS's platforms are better for technical analysis and algorithmic trading, while Libertex's platform suits beginners who want simplicity. Both platforms are available in English and support mobile trading on the go.

FBS is regulated by the International Financial Services Commission (IFSC) of Belize, while Libertex is regulated by the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C). Neither broker is directly regulated by the local financial regulator in Botswana, so traders should exercise caution. CySEC regulation offers stronger investor protection under EU standards, while IFSC provides a more flexible environment. For Botswana traders, this means understanding the level of protection and considering deposit insurance options.

Both FBS and Libertex off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Botswana Muslim traders. FBS provides these accounts on all account types without additional fees, while Libertex offers them upon request. These accounts eliminate overnight swap charges, making them compliant with Sharia law. Botswana traders should note that Islamic accounts may have reduced leverage or longer holding periods. Confirm availability with customer support before opening an account.
